The MC33397DWR2 is a highly integrated circuit chip designed for automotive applications. Some of its advantages and application scenarios include:1. High integration: The MC33397DWR2 integrates various functions required for automotive applications, such as a LIN transceiver, voltage regulator, watchdog timer, and low-dropout regulator. This high level of integration reduces the need for external components and simplifies the design process.2. LIN communication: The chip supports the Local Interconnect Network (LIN) protocol, which is widely used in automotive applications for communication between various electronic control units (ECUs). It provides a reliable and cost-effective solution for in-vehicle networking.3. Robustness and reliability: The MC33397DWR2 is designed to meet the stringent requirements of the automotive industry, including high-temperature operation, ESD protection, and electromagnetic compatibility (EMC). It can withstand harsh automotive environments and ensure reliable operation.4. Low power consumption: The chip is designed to operate with low power consumption, making it suitable for automotive applications where power efficiency is crucial. It helps to extend the battery life and reduce overall power consumption in the vehicle.5. Application scenarios: The MC33397DWR2 is commonly used in automotive applications such as body control modules, lighting control modules, HVAC systems, seat control modules, and other electronic control units that require LIN communication and integration of multiple functions.Overall, the MC33397DWR2 integrated circuit chip offers advantages such as high integration, LIN communication support, robustness, low power consumption, and is suitable for various automotive applications.
